Deep Sawhney, owner of The Erogenous Zone (E-Zone), a sexy store in Philadelphia, said this Halloween season was slower at his store than last season, although sales did pick up close to Halloween. “We sold accessories more than costumes, which was true last year as well,” he said. “A lot of people were putting their own costumes together.”
Best-selling brands were Leg Avenue and Dreamgirl, as well as Rubie’s “because of their licensed costumes. They do more and more each year.”
In trends; “The cougar was big. People wanted leotards, jumpsuits and pirates again. Seductive gypsies were also in. Lady Gaga was very popular as well.”
He said about his expectations for 2011: “It all depends on the economy. I expect us to sell more accessories [once again]. I think everyone is at a different price range now: [they will spend] about $45 to $50 on a costume, whereas [they used to spend] in the $70 range.”
